AppCL LSM: Implementing and managing application oriented access controls

This talk will take a different perspective to the talk at Securi-Tay V. I will take a higher level look at how AppCL LSM achieves its goal of implementing application oriented access controls.

As well as a discussion on AppCL LSM and its use of the Linux Security Module (LSM) framework, I will provide demonstrations of AppCL LSM in use. The python tool ‘appcl.py’ will be used to demonstrate the management of the security module and it’s policies.
